30 <sect2 role="package">
31 <title>Introduction to GStreamer Good Plug-ins</title>
32
33 <para>The <application>GStreamer Good Plug-ins</application> is a set of
34 plug-ins considered by the <application>GStreamer</application> developers
35 to have good quality code, correct functionality, and the preferred license
36 (LGPL for the plug-in code, LGPL or LGPL-compatible for the supporting
37 library). A wide range of video and audio decoders, encoders, and filters
38 are included. Also see the <xref linkend="gst-plugins-ugly"/>, <ulink
39 url="http://gstreamer.freedesktop.org/modules/gst-plugins-bad.html">
40 GStreamer Bad Plug-ins</ulink> and <ulink
41 url="http://gstreamer.freedesktop.org/modules/gst-ffmpeg.html">GStreamer
42 FFmpeg plug-in</ulink> packages.</para>

110 <sect2 role="installation">
111 <title>Installation of GStreamer Good Plug-ins</title>
112
113 <para>Install <application>GStreamer Good Plug-ins</application> by running
114 the following commands:</para>
115
116<screen><userinput>./configure --prefix=/usr \
117 --sysconfdir=&gnome-etc-dir; &amp;&amp;
118make</userinput></screen>
119
120 <para>To test the results, issue: <command>make check</command>. There are
121 many other <filename>Makefile</filename> targets you can specify for
122 running the tests, issue <command>make -C tests/check help</command> to see
123 the complete list.</para>
124
125 <para>Now, as the <systemitem class="username">root</systemitem> user:</para>
126
127<screen role="root"><userinput>make install</userinput></screen>
128
129 <para>If you did not rebuild the API documentation by passing
130 <option>--enable-gtk-doc</option> to the <command>configure</command>
131 script and you wish to install the pre-built documentation, issue the
132 following command as the <systemitem class="username">root</systemitem>
133 user:</para>
134
135<screen role="root"><userinput>make -C docs/plugins install-data</userinput></screen>
136
137 </sect2>
138
139 <sect2 role="commands">
140 <title>Command Explanations</title>
141
142 <para><parameter>--sysconfdir=&gnome-etc-dir;</parameter>: This parameter
143 is used so that the <application>GConf</application> configuration files
144 are installed in the system-wide GNOME <application>GConf</application>
145 database located in
146 <filename class="directory">&gnome-etc-dir;/gconf</filename>
147 instead of <filename class="directory">/usr/etc</filename>. You may omit
148 this parameter if you don't have <application>GConf</application>
149 installed.</para>
